January weather forecast
Paternion, Austria

January

Weather in January

January, like December, is another subzero cold winter month in Paternion, Austria, with an average temperature fluctuating between -7.8°C (18°F) and -0.8°C (30.6°F).

Temperature

January is the month that records the lowest temperatures, with averages ranging from a high of -0.8°C (30.6°F) to a low of -7.8°C (18°F).

Humidity

In Paternion, Austria, the average relative humidity in January is 87%.

Rainfall

The month with the least rainfall is January, when the rain falls for 8.9 days and typically collects 49mm (1.93") of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, September through December. In Paternion, during January, snow falls for 18.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 403mm (15.87") of snow. In Paternion, during the entire year, snow falls for 107.4 days and aggregates up to 2734mm (107.64") of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January is 9h and 3min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 07:49 and sunset at 16:27.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 07:31 and sunset at 17:06 CET.

Sunshine

In Paternion, the average sunshine in January is 5.3h.

UV index

The month with the lowest UV index is January, with an average maximum UV index of 1.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um high daily UV index of 1 during January translates into the following directions:
Most individuals face no significant issues with extended sun exposure, but it is always essential to protect children, babies, and those with sensitive skin. The Sun's harshest UV rays are around midday; it's wise to seek shade and limit time outdoors. Stay sun-safe with clothing that is both closely woven and worn loosely. Beware! Reflection from snow can magnify the Sun's UV radiation nearly twofold.
